To help you arm yourself with the information you need to make your decision, Grad Degree Search has developed this Best Value Linguistics & Literature Schools in Indiana ranking. Our analysis looked at 4 schools in Indiana to see which programs offered the best value experiences for comparative literature students with the aim of identifying those quality schools that are more affordable than some of their counterparts.

When determining this ranking, we place a high emphasis on the school's quality as well as its sticker price. Even though a college may be affordable, it may not offer value.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.

Our calculations use out-of-state tuition and fees in our nationwide and regional rankings.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

#1

Ball State University

Muncie, IN
$10,290 Average Tuition & Fees

Our 2023 rankings named Ball State University the best value school in Indiana for linguistics and comparative literature students. Located in the city of Muncie, Ball State is a public school with a very large student population.

In-state tuition fees for undergraduate students at Ball State are $10,290 per year.

Ball State not only placed well in our value ranking, but it is also #5 on our Best Linguistics & Literature Schools in Indiana list.
